30 and 60 Day Late Removal Question

I had a 60 month auto loan that I opened in 2006  and in 2010 purchased a new vehicle and let a friend sublease the remaining payments from me (big mistake). Well the friend ended up falling behind on the payments and the last 5 months of the loan were all late as follows:

 

June 2011- 30 Day Late

July 2011- 30 Day Late

August 2011- 30 Day Late

September 2011- 60 Day Late

October 2011- 30 Day Late

 

October was the last payment and the loan was then completed and the car was paid off.

 

This is the only thing left on my credit that is negative and I literally have sent 20 goodwill letters and countless emails over the last 12 months trying to get the bank to either delete the tradeline or remove the lates. Finally today after a year of trying I received an email with an offer to delete the 30 day late from October and the 60 day late from September.

 

Will this help my score at all or is it pointless because of the lates right before them?

 

My plan is to accept the removal of the lates and after there removed keep trying to get the rest removed but I'm curious if at least getting these deleted will help.

Re: 30 and 60 Day Late Removal Question

Those two are the newest lates, with the 60 days being the biggest late.  Getting those removed because they are less than 2 years old will probably help some.  The rest of them are over 2 years old and probably are having no impact on your score now..
